Transaction 4906593396d575fa4f698fc33d4a48eb9010c8db47c9bf0a92e66091de09a808
1 Input
1 Output
-
4906593396d575fa4f698fc33d4a48eb9010c8db47c9bf0a92e66091de09a808:0
- value
- 1970112
- script pubkey
- OP_0 OP_PUSHBYTES_32 ea3ba82f4675deae47da6d222aea86c7ea87d2c69489ae852c1dcd4b23a08248
- address
- bc1qaga6st6xwh02u376d53z465xcl4g05kxjjy6apfvrhx5kgaqsfyq3zagw6